WebDirect fecal smear technique is the simplest and easiest technique to facilitate … Web1 okt. 2013 · Results. Of the 110 stool samples collected, 28 (25%) were detected positive for the presence of Blastocystis sp. by two or more tests. Culture method detected the highest number of Blastocystis-positive stool samples (n=36), followed by PCR of DNA extracted from culture (n=26), PCR of DNA extracted from stool (n=10), and direct fecal …

WebFecal Direct Smear. Indications for performing this test: This simple procedure is used for rapid analysis of feces in a clinical setting. Though it is not as sensitive as a fecal flotation, heavy infestations will be detected by this method.For some parasites, this is the preferred method of collection.
